What makes an iconic book cover?

By Clare Thorp

 

p08g0s07.jpg

 

A pair of eyes and red lips floating in a midnight sky above the bright lights of New York on The Great Gatsby.

 

The half-man, half-devil on Brett Easton Ellis’s American Psycho.

 

A single cog for an eye on A Clockwork Orange.

 

Two orange silhouettes on David Nicholls’ One Day.
